Alabama's business entity database is a crucial resource for business owners and established businesses alike. By utilizing the Alabama Secretary of State's business search features, individuals can readily access information regarding different business entities functioning within the state. This includes options like the Alabama Secretary of State business entity search and the Alabama SOS entity search, which facilitate the process of finding detailed information about companies, limited liability companies, and partnerships.

The database provides important information such as the status of a business, its registered address, and the names of its officers or partners. For those considering forming a new entity or researching existing businesses, the Alabama Secretary of State corporation search can be especially.  alabama secretary of state business  helps in ensuring that the proposed business name is available and complies with state regulations, thus aiding in the effective establishment of a new business venture.

Additionally, users can take advantage of the Alabama Secretary of State UCC search to explore financial documents and other legal documents associated with businesses. Using UCC Searches for Business Expansion

Uniform Commercial Code searches, or Uniform Commercial Code searches, serve a critical role in assisting companies protect their monetary stakes and encourage development. In the state of Alabama, the State Secretary facilitates a efficient UCC investigation procedure that allows startups to detect existing claims against a business's resources. This is crucial for conducting knowledgeable decisions when engaging in monetary agreements, acquiring new financing, or increasing activities. By carrying out a detailed UCC investigation through the Secretary of State of Alabama’s portal, business owners can minimize hazards and guarantee they are not unintentionally burdened by previous claims.

Investigating LLC and Corporation Searches in Alabama

In the State of Alabama, the importance of performing a comprehensive search for LLCs and corporations cannot be underestimated. Entrepreneurs looking to start a new business must make use of the State of Alabama Secretary of State business entity search tools. This includes features such as the Alabama secretary of state entity search and the alabama secretary of state corporation search, both of which provide vital information about current businesses. These resources ensure that aspiring business owners can check the usability of their desired business name and ensure that no comparable entities already operate.

The Alabama Secretary of State Limited Liability Company search serves as a critical step in the formation process. It enables individuals to check if their chosen LLC name is already in use or too similar to an existing business, helping to avoid issues down the road. Utilizing the Alabama Secretary of State entity search can uncover crucial details such as the entity's standing, the date of establishment, and even its registered agent data.
